Course Objectives:
At the end of the course the students are expected to:
1. Become familiar with the basics of computer communication.
2. Understand analogue and digital transmission in communication.
3. Elaborate the functionality of OSI layers and TCP/IP protocols.
4. Understand the modern network concepts.
